Band 5+: It is unacceptable that people who work in certain professions, e.g. finance, media, entertainment and sport, are paid such high salaries while others, who do more important jobs in society, are underpaid. To what extent do you agree or disagree?

Note: Both the topic and the essay were created by one of our users.

It is true that people working in the entertainment, media, and sports are paid higher compared to people who do more important jobs, such as people working in the medical field, economists, teachers, and others. In my opinion, both people working in entertainment, media or other fields should receive an equal salary.

Firstly, media and sports are a strength to the country as they represent the country globally. It is true that world-renowned sportsmen are paid millions of dollars per appearance. For example, sportsmen can’t always compete, which means they can’t win money. They can also get injured during competitions. It’s good that they get paid more than others because they put their health at risk. Even actors can’t always make money. Because they wait and train for years to get a major role.

On the other hand, the government should give more attention to the community working in other fields, such as surgeons, economists, and teachers. Surgeons spend about seven years to become one. However, their salary is comparatively low. Doctors and nurses work extra long hours, but their salary is comparatively less. Similarly, teachers are paid less compared to the work they do. Teachers have to work a minimum of six hours at school, and they also spend extra time checking students’ homework. However, they receive less payment, and in order for them to earn more, they have to do extra classes.

In conclusion, it is true that people in the entertainment, sports, and other fields are paid more than surgeons or teachers. I believe that all the people who perform an important job in society should be paid equally.
